WHY SEXUAL ATTRACTION MAY CAUSE DIFFICULTIES IN DECISIONMAKING PROCESSES

Sexual tension is a common phenomenon that can occur between people who are attracted to each other but may not be able to act on their desires due to circumstances such as being co-workers or having different romantic partners. When these situations arise, individuals may experience heightened feelings of attraction, leading to physical and emotional reactions that can impact their ability to make rational decisions. This can create a shift in the decision-making process, making it more difficult for those involved to maintain objectivity and focus solely on the task at hand. In this essay, I will explore how sexual tensions affect the emotional atmosphere of decision-making spaces, discussing the implications for clarity, neutrality, and psychological safety.

Sexual Tensions and Decision Making

When individuals find themselves in close proximity to someone they desire, they may become distracted from the task at hand and begin to fixate on the person's appearance, mannerisms, or interactions. This can lead to a preoccupation with thoughts about sex or relationships, which can interfere with their ability to think clearly and remain focused. The body also experiences changes during periods of sexual arousal, causing an increase in heart rate, sweating, and blood flow to certain areas. These physiological responses can further disrupt concentration, making it harder for individuals to concentrate on the matter at hand.

The emotions associated with sexual attraction can alter the decision-making process by creating a sense of urgency or pressure. Individuals may feel compelled to take action quickly out of fear of missing out on an opportunity or losing the chance to act on their desires. This can lead them to make rash decisions without fully considering all available options, potentially resulting in negative consequences.

Impact on Clarity

The presence of sexual tension can also reduce transparency in communication due to fears of rejection or embarrassment. Individuals may hesitate to express their feelings openly, leading to misunderstandings and confusion that can impact decision-making processes. When individuals are not clear about their own wants and needs, they may fail to communicate effectively with others, leading to misaligned expectations and disagreements over plans of action.

Impact on Neutrality

Sexual tensions can introduce bias into decision-making processes as individuals prioritize personal desires above professional goals or objectivity.

Co-workers who are attracted to each other may be more likely to work together on projects than those who are not, leading to favorable treatment and unequal distribution of resources.

Individuals may become biased towards solutions that align with their personal values or preferences rather than objective facts or data.

Impact on Psychological Safety

Sexual tensions can create an environment where individuals feel unsafe emotionally, which can impact their ability to participate freely in group discussions or express dissenting opinions. Fear of rejection or judgment can cause individuals to self-censor or avoid speaking up altogether, leading to a loss of diverse perspectives and reduced creativity. This can result in less effective decision-making outcomes, especially when multiple viewpoints are needed for successful problem-solving.

The emotional atmosphere created by sexual tension can have significant effects on decision-making processes, making it harder for individuals to maintain clarity, neutrality, and psychological safety. By recognizing these potential challenges, individuals can take steps to mitigate them by establishing clear boundaries, seeking support from trusted friends or mentors, and engaging in open communication with all stakeholders involved. By doing so, they can ensure that their decisions are based on evidence rather than emotion and promote fairness, transparency, and inclusiveness within teams and organizations.
